Volcanoe Science Volcanology (also spelled vulcanology) is the study of volcanoes, lava, magma and related geological, geophysical and geochemical phenomena ( volcanism ). The term volcanology is derived from the Latin word vulcan. Vulcan was the ancient Roman god of fire. volcanism, any of various processes and phenomena associated with the surficial discharge of molten rock, pyroclastic fragments, or hot water and steam, including volcanoes, geysers, and fumaroles. The distribution of active volcanoes ( Plate 27.26) The three main types of volcanoes are cinder cones, composite volcanoes (stratovolcanoes) and shield volcanoes. Lava domes are a common fourth type of volcano. However, there are other kinds of volcanoes, plus they are compound or complex volcanoes that have features of multiple types. A volcano is a spot in Earthu0027s crust where molten rock, volcanic ash and certain types of gases escape from an underground chamber. Magma is the name for that molten rock when itu0027s below ground. Scientists call it lava once that liquid rock erupts from the ground — and may start flowing across Earthu0027s surface. The La Cumbre volcano on Fernandina Island, the third largest in the Galapagos, has begun a new eruption. The Geophysical Institute of Ecuador said a 'thermal anomaly and a gas emission' were detected near midnight Sunday, Mar.3 at the 1,476-meter volcano, which registered eruptive activity in 2018 and 2020. Volcanoes - National Geographic Society Volcanic eruption | Description, History, Mythology, & Facts A volcano is an opening in a planet or moonu0027s crust through which molten rock, hot gases, and other materials erupt. Volcanoes often form a hill or mountain as layers of rock and ash build up from repeated eruptions. Volcanoes are classified as active, dormant, or extinct. volcano, vent in the crust of Earth or another planet or satellite, from which issue eruptions of molten rock, hot rock fragments, and hot gases. A volcano is an opening on the surface of a planet or moon that allows material warmer than its surroundings to escape from its interior. When this material escapes, it causes an eruption. An eruption can be explosive, sending material high into the sky. Or it can be calmer, with gentle flows of material.
